区块链节点人是什么?解析、作用与未来发展

区块链技术的迅猛发展已引起了全球范围内的广泛关注。在这个新技术的核心中,节点这一概念扮演着至关重要的角色。尤其是“节点人”这一特定角色,其功能与意义值得深入探讨。那么,什么是区块链节点人?他们在区块链网络中又肩负着怎样的责任与使命?在这篇文章中,我们将对区块链节点人进行详细探讨,并解答一些与之相关的常见问题。 ### 什么是区块链节点人? 区块链节点人,顾名思义,是指在区块链网络中扮演“节点”角色的人。节点是指网络中具有独立功能并参与数据处理和传输的计算机或设备。每个节点都可以存储区块链中的数据,还能够参与区块的验证和确认。因此,节点人实际上就是参与这些节点工作的个体或组织。 节点分为不同的类型,主要包括: 1. **全节点(Full Node)**:全节点存储整个区块链的完整历史,能够验证任何一笔交易的有效性。全节点通常负责网络的安全性和稳定性。 2. **轻节点(Light Node)**:轻节点只存储区块链的一部分数据,主要依赖全节点来验证交易。这类节点的优点在于对硬件要求较低,适合移动设备和个人用户。 3. **矿工节点(Miner Node)**:矿工节点负责区块的生成,通过解决复杂的数学难题来完成新区块的加入。矿工获得的奖励是交易手续费和区块奖励。 在这些节点中,节点人往往拥有自己的利益和目标,有的可能是为了维持网络的稳定性,有的则可能希望通过矿业获得经济利益。 ### 节点人在区块链中的作用 在区块链生态系统中,节点人扮演着多个重要角色: 1. **数据存储与处理**:节点人负责保存和管理区块链上的数据,确保信息的实时更新和备份。这在防止数据丢失和保证系统安全性上具有不可或缺的作用。 2. **交易验证**:节点人参与交易的验证与确认过程,确保交易的合法性和有效性。这一过程是维持区块链技术信任的基础。 3. **网络安全**:每个节点通过其加密验证机制,提高了整个区块链网络的安全性。通过分散化的节点设计,区块链避免了单点故障的风险。 4. **机制与治理参与**:部分区块链网络允许节点人在协议的升级与变化中提出意见或投票,这为整个网络的治理提供了基础。 5. **经济激励**: 挖矿节点通过完成工作获取奖励,提高了用户参与网络建设的积极性,推动了区块链生态的不断发展。 ### 区块链节点人面临的挑战 尽管节点人在区块链中扮演着重要角色,但他们也面临诸多挑战: 1. **技术门槛**:参与区块链节点的设置与维护,往往需要用户具备一定的计算机知识。普通用户可能难以顺利加入这一行列。 2. **硬件成本**:全节点需要较高的存储和计算能力,普通用户可能面临设备、带宽和电力等成本的压力。 3. **安全风险**:节点人需防范网络攻击,尤其是对于矿工节点而言,黑客攻击可能导致巨额损失。 4. **政策风险**:全球对区块链技术的监管政策尚未成熟,不同国家的法律法规不同,为节点人的操作带来不确定性。 ### 相关问题探讨 #### 区块链节点人如何参与网络? 参与区块链网络的方式有很多,首先,用户需要选择一个合适的区块链平台,例如比特币、以太坊等。然后根据所选平台的要求进行节点的设置。以下是更详细的步骤: 1. **选择平台**:选择一个感兴趣的区块链平台,了解其特点与要求。 2. **硬件准备**:确保拥有合适的硬件环境。全节点需要较强的计算能力和存储空间,轻节点则相对要求较低。 3. **下载客户端**:根据平台的官方文档,下载并安装相应的客户端程序。 4. **配置节点**:按照文档指导配置节点,设置网络连接和必要的参数。 5. **开始运行**:一切设置完成后,启动节点程序并在网络中运行。 6. **参与社区**:加入相关的社区,与其他节点人交流经验,共同推动区块链的发展。 7. **锻炼技术**:随着对区块链技术的了解加深,节点人可以进一步学习更高级的操作,例如参与区块链的开发和治理。 #### 区块链节点人如何保障网络安全? 节点人保障网络安全的方式多样,包括: 1. **数据加密**:通过对数据进行加密,确保信息传输的安全性。 2. **防火墙设置**:为节点设置防火墙,阻止未授权的访问和攻击。 3. **及时更新**:保持节点软件的更新,确保使用最新的安全补丁,避免潜在的漏洞。 4. **风险评估**:定期进行安全风险评估,及时识别并处理潜在的安全风险。 5. **参与社区**:参与相关的安全社区,了解最新的安全趋势和攻击手法。 6. **备份机制**:设置数据备份机制,避免因意外情况导致数据丢失。 #### 为何要成为区块链节点人? 选择成为区块链节点人,有诸多理由: 1. **技术体验**:通过实际操作,更深入地了解区块链技术及其运作方式。 2. **经济收益**:通过参与挖矿等方式,节点人可以获得一定的经济收益,尤其是在参与一些新兴的区块链项目时。 3. **网络安全**:成为节点人,有助于提高区块链网络的安全性,维护整个生态系统的稳定。 4. **参与治理**:在一些区块链协议中,节点人有机会参与网络的治理与决策,增强了他们的参与感和责任感。 5. **社区建设**:与其他区块链爱好者交流、学习,丰富自身的网络资源和人脉。 #### 区块链节点人的未来发展趋势 区块链技术及其应用在不断发展,节点人的角色与职责也在变化。未来,节点人的发展趋势可能包括: 1. **去中心化趋势**:随着更多的人参与到区块链网络中,节点的去中心化将进一步加深,促进网络的安全与稳定。 2. **与5G等技术结合**:区块链技术与5G等新兴技术的结合,将使节点人的参与更加便捷,降低参与门槛。 3. **智能合约的应用**:智能合约的应用将使节点人在治理与决策中扮演更重要的角色。 4. **监管政策的成熟**:随着各国对区块链技术的监管政策逐渐成熟,节点人的角色和责任也会变得更加清晰,提供更好的发展环境。 综上所述,区块链节点人在整个区块链网络中具有不可替代的作用,他们不仅是技术链条中的参与者,更是这个新兴技术生态系统的重要一环。随着技术的发展,节点人的未来仍将充满无限可能。